Output 8fa385a1849a89e3788bc57322a495812ecfbb079daa3cec63972de8d349fe94:21

value
2310679
script pubkey
OP_0 OP_PUSHBYTES_20 7b5a4bbdcb6703b364ade7be35ee7fea782e1655
address
bc1q0ddyh0wtvupmxe9du7lrtmnlafuzu9j45nzc74
transaction
8fa385a1849a89e3788bc57322a495812ecfbb079daa3cec63972de8d349fe94